Re: No CEP2 Work

It could be that Linux-only problem. But you have a lot of projects; BOINC tends to get all confused in that case (actually it inevitably does so with far fewer projects than that whenever I try it). It may be an example of the following problem due to the "Recent Estimated Credit" technique that the BOINC scheduler uses, though the messages differ:
https://secure.worldcommunitygrid.org/forums/...ad,35738_offset,60#436362

The only solution I have found is to run only one CPU project (WCG for me) and only one GPU project on any given machine. If I want to run other projects, I use a different PC. In your case, I would let all the projects run dry, uninstall BOINC and especially delete the BOINC data folder, and start over with fewer projects. Or you could just wait and see if it starts behaving properly; you never know.

Re: No CEP2 Work

Nattgew, had the same thing, but right smack from clean install... after some 36 hours or so the CEP2 started to come. Some members found a simple ''toggling' of the project selections worked for them. Select MCM1+FAAH, deselect CEP2 > Save > Hit update and study messages. Then select CEP2 exclusively, deselect all else, including "if there is no wrk". If the client then tries fetching work from WCG, it will hopefully tell why [bandwidth?... you've entered a restriction]. Just let it sit as no amount of reinstalling will do this... my cards is on something funky on the server side... flags not passing to the feeder properly. On each connect the client is supposed to tell the server about the current config and basis bases the 'send yes/no' decision on that. For that, start with hitting the Clear button in the client computing preferences screen to remove local prefs, so only the Website device profile options rule, which presently are ignored per

10-Nov-2013 19:27:28 [---] Reading preferences override file

Then mod in the appropriate web device profile and hit update again in client, twice, for more observation. First hit to transfer web prefs to client from server, second update to let it request work based on latest web prfs [yes that's right... the server wants to know the latest latest from the client, each and every time]

I'm runnning the Gianfranco Locutusofborg ppa package of 7.2.28 on Ubuntu now... no issues.
